Will these keyboards work on any computer?
Yes. The keyboards themselves are of a universal design standard and will
operate on any PC. However, as they are dual language keyboards, you will
need to change the language settings in your computer so that it knows
when you are typing in English, and when you are typing in Russian. Once
set, you can switch between English and Russian whenever you like at the
click of a mouse. If you do not know how to change the language settings
in your computer, just follow the set-up instruction links on the bottom
right of this page.
I have a laptop computer, will the keyboard work
on that?
Yes. Many of our customers use English language laptops, and simply plug
in the Russian keyboard when they want to work in Cyrillic. You will need
a spare USB socket on your laptopm and the language settings of your computer
will need to be adjusted as mentioned above.

Should I go for a standard keyboard or a multimedia
one?
Standard keyboards are fine for the office environment, or where price
or desk space is important. However, multimedia keyboards have inbuilt
'Hot Keys', which are basically short-cuts that open your favourite programmes.
So, for example, rather than going through a series of screens to open
up Microsoft Word, you just simply hit one button and the application
opens up instantly. With up to 15 'Hot Keys' this sort of time saving
advantage can make a big difference, especially when you think about the
amount of time you spend at your computer each day. Multimedia keyboards
tend to be slightly more expensive, but we have managed to find a good
range to suit all budgets.

Can you get hold of Cyrillic keyed laptops?
Yes we can, but they tend to be very expensive as the manufacturers charge
a premium to fit Cyrillic keycaps and then you end up with a laptop that
you would struggle to trade-in or sell second hand in the UK. We find
that it is much better, and much cheaper to simply plug in an external
keyboard via a USB socket and use it whenever you wish. We were looking
at supplying flexible silicone keyboards in Russian as these simply roll
up and fit into a small bag, making them the ideal companion for the notebook
or laptop user, but couldn't find any to meet our quality standards.
